C语言中的class的应用?

C语言中的class的应用


qq_遁去的一_1
浏览 1633回答 4
4回答

莫回无

你说的class是类的吧,在c语言中是没有这个概念的,我指的是编程,class是c++中引入的,与c语言中的结构体有类似的地方,但是又有很大的不同,class中可以定义成员变量还可以定义方法也就是函数(c中概念),但是结构体却不能定义方法,这是一大不同,另外就是类class定义对象,结构体是定义的值,两个是不同的定义,大的方向你要搞清楚class是面向对象编程中的概念,c语言中的结构体是面向过程编程中应用的,各自的用法都是用来编写程序,class的定义以及用法,你可以参考下c++相关基础会清楚些,

米琪卡哇伊

在一个文件中定义结构体,数据成员直接声明,方法成员声明一个函数指针,然后在结构外面定义这些方法成员就行了
打开App,查看更多内容
随时随地看视频慕课网APP